Output 3de59bf36b8b35102af8b6f7af59a3d156ea68a6cbb4d0516aee317bd50226b1:2

value
1000098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15f53e3a293a384083c912cf69355021c83f0e4d OP_EQUAL
address
33h7uMpWtBPoYYS6NroUPFsfdMn57iKyJq
transaction
3de59bf36b8b35102af8b6f7af59a3d156ea68a6cbb4d0516aee317bd50226b1
spent
true